Michael Chopak, Age 83 of Prospect Street, Troy, PA passed away Saturday, July 18, 2015 at Robert Packer Hospital in Sayre. Michael was born April 26, 1932 in Scranton son of the late John & Stella (Budjinski) Chopak, Sr. Mike was a graduate of local schools and attended two years of college. He served his country with the US Air Force from 1951 to 1955. He and the former Frances C. Chrzan were married September 9, 1992 and celebrated 22 years together. Mike previously ran the Alba General Store and was the Alba Postmaster for many years. His memberships included the Troy American Legion and was a past member of the Troy Lions Club. He was a devout Boston Red Sox Fan and enjoyed carpentry and reading in his past time.
